The Western Area Power Administration, under the Department of Energy, is forecasting a contract for solid waste collection services at its Montrose facility in Colorado, targeting the pickup of both trash and recycling. The acquisition is designated as a small business set-aside under NAICS code 562111, indicating a preference for small business vendors to perform the service. The solicitation is currently in the pre-release forecast stage, with no formal solicitation number assigned yet, and the posted date reflects an initial publication in August 2026. The services will be performed exclusively at the RMR Montrose Facility, and no contract award date is specified as the opportunity remains in the planning phase. Two Small Business Program Managers are listed as points of contact, both reachable via email through the WAPA domain, providing information and guidance to interested small businesses preparing responses.
